In a triangle `A B C ,` if `A-B=120^0a n dsinA/2sinB/2sinC/2=1/(32),` then the value of `8cosC` is_______

Text Solution

Verified by Experts

The correct Answer is:
7

`2 sin ""(A)/(2) sin ""(B)/(2) sin ""(C )/(2)= (1)/(16)`
`rArr ( cos ""(A-B)/(2) - cos ""(A+B)/(2)) sin ""(C )/(2) = (1)/(16)`
or `sin ""(C )/(2) ( (1)/(2) - sin ""(C )/(2))= (1)/(16)`
or `sin ^(2)""(C )/(2) -(1)/(2) sin""(C )/(2) + (1)/(16) = 0 `
or `((1)/(4) - sin ""(C ) /(2))^(2) =0`
or `sin""(C )/(2) = (1)/(4)`
or `cos C =1- 2 sin ^(2) ""(C )/(2) = 1 - (1)/(8) = (7)/(8)`
